CPR as the backbone
If you take only one skill from your North Lakes emergency treatment course, make it quality CPR. Compressions that are deep sufficient, quick enough, and unbroken are the foundation. Adults call for 2 hands centered on the breast bone, at the very least 5 cm deep, 100 to 120 compressions per minute. The beat of Stayin' Alive is seriously, it matches the target range. For small-framed rescuers or older grownups, instructors demonstrate how to pile shoulders above hands and use body weight to accomplish deepness without tiring the arms. That adjustment matters if you are twenty compressions away from quiting as well soon.
The 2nd column is early defibrillation. Public access defibrillators have spread out around North Lakes in shopping precincts, recreation center, and showing off clubs. Throughout CPR training North Lakes sessions, you will certainly exercise turning an unit on, adhering to voice prompts, getting rid of onlookers before a shock, and returning to compressions right away. This cycle, compressions to evaluation to shock to compressions, is basic enough that panic is the major opponent. Practice knocks the side off panic.
A note on youngsters and babies: you will certainly learn the distinctions in hand positioning, compression depth, and rescue breaths. Exercising on pediatric manikins issues. Muscular tissue memory improved adult-only technique does not convert flawlessly to a small breast. An excellent instructor will certainly run you with child and baby mouth-to-mouth resuscitation up until the movements really feel natural.
Real situations, actual judgment
Textbook actions are cool. Actual scenes are messy. A choking young child might also be frightened and wriggling. An individual with a substance crack could be going into shock while their companion demands you draw them to the ute. Emergency treatment training in North Lakes is most beneficial when it drills judgment as high as technique.
Two scenarios stick out from current sessions I observed. In the very first, a simulated anaphylaxis case, the student administered an adrenaline auto-injector properly yet forgot to call Three-way No for follow-up. The fitness instructor stopped briefly the space and mentioned the half-finished task. Adrenaline gets time, it does not guarantee resolution. Thirty seconds of direction reshaped the trainee's practice loophole: deal with, call, check, prepare a 2nd dosage if available.
In the 2nd, the team dealt with a simulated seizure at a market stall. The impulse to hold the person still was strong. The instructor redirected them to clear risks, cushion the head, time the convulsions, then place the person sideways when movements stopped. No restrictions, no objects in the mouth. The scene after that added a spin: the individual remained baffled and combative. The group needed to balance safety with peace of mind, an ability you only find out by trying.

What training can not do, and what it can
First aid is not medication. It does not change paramedics, diagnostics, or treatment. It is about stabilisation, danger minimisation, and decision-making under time stress. If you only remember 3 words, make them evaluate, act, and handover. Assess the scene and the person, act upon the life risks before you, after that hand the person to greater care with a tranquility, factual recap. Excellent first aid minimizes harm throughout the space in between case and ambulance.
That last action, the handover, is underrated. Throughout North Lakes emergency treatment training courses, insist on practicing it. Speak simply put, concrete sentences. State the individual's approximate age, their key complaint, what you saw first, what you did, and exactly how they reacted. Ten clear seconds can conserve a paramedic from re-checking something you currently handled.

Edge cases you must believe through
Sometimes the scene will certainly test the limits of your training. A bleeding person that refuses help. A collapsed teen that urges they are fine. A diabetic person that is too sluggish to ingest safely. A kid with a recognized extreme allergic reaction who left their auto-injector in the house. In each case, the framework holds. Maintain yourself and bystanders safe, ask for professional assistance early when uncertain, and act upon life risks you can plainly recognize. Indicated authorization applies when an individual is unresponsive or not able to make reasonable decisions, specifically children. For mindful grownups rejecting aid, stay calm and keep them under monitoring while waiting for paramedics if you have already called.
Another complicated area is back suspicion. Area first aid no longer stresses inflexible immobilisation with improvisated collars. The concern is to avoid twisting and to maintain the individual comfy till assistance shows up. If they need to vomit or their air passage goes to risk, you will still prioritise breathing over ideal spinal column positioning, turning them as one system when possible. These subtleties are where an experienced instructor gains their fee.
